URGENT PRINTING NEWS:

Starting with the Spring semester 2012 your new balance is $40. Check your PaperCut balance. Single sided pages will cost 10 cents and double sided costs 14 cents (7 cents per side). "Top Up" cards can be purchased for those who use more than their $40 balance.
